Problems solved by technology

[0002] Plastic packaging bag is a kind of packaging bag that uses plastic as raw material to produce various daily necessities. It is widely used in daily life and industrial production. The commonly used plastic packaging bags are mostly composite PET with polyethylene as the inner layer material. The film made of PET aluminum, aluminum foil, PA and other materials is non-toxic, so it can be used to hold food. There is also a film made of polyvinyl chloride, which is also non-toxic, but it depends on the use of the film. The additives added are often harmful substances to the human body and have certain toxicity, so this type of film and the plastic bag made of the film are not suitable for holding food
[0003] Plastic packaging bags are common packaging bags on the market at present. Plastic packaging bags generally need to go through the heat sealing process of the inner layer to form a sealed packaging bag. The heat sealing temperature of PE is generally around 120°C, while plastic packaging bags are generally more Layer composite materials, when heat-sealing, the film in contact with the equipment is always the outermost film. At a temperature above 120°C, the outermost film often has wrinkles and other problems caused by prolonged exposure to high temperature. When the appearance is defective, the inner layer is usually not heated to a temperature sufficient for heat sealing, which leads to appearance defects of the heat-sealed product after heat sealing, resulting in unsightly appearance of the product, and even because the outer layer is heat-sealed for too long , leading to waste

Abstract

The invention discloses an ultralow-temperature PE film and a raw material process thereof. The ultralow-temperature PE film comprises a film outer layer, a film middle layer and a film inner layer, wherein the film middle layer is arranged at one side of the film inner layer; the film inner layer and the film middle layer are fused together through three-layer co-extrusion; the film outer layer is arranged at one side of the film middle layer; and the film middle layer and the film outer layer are fused together through three-layer co-extrusion. The ultralow-temperature PE film provided by the invention achieves the following functions: the heat sealing temperature of a plastic film is reduced; the time of heat sealing is shortened; the quality of film appearance is guaranteed; and the rate of a finished product is improved.
